Thermochemical parameters of 1,2,3,4-tetrahydroquinoline adducts of some divalent transition metal bromides ()
ABSTRACT
The adducts [MBr2(L)n], where M = Fe, Co, Ni, Cu or Zn; L = 1,2,3,4-tetrahydroquinoline (THQ); n = 0.75, 1 or 2 have been obtained from the interaction in hot solution of THQ with the metal(II) bromides. The compounds were characterized by melting points, elemental analysis, thermal analysis and IR spectroscopy. From calorimetric studies in solution, the standard enthalpies of formation of them and several other thermochemical parameters were determined. The mean standard enthalpies of the metal(II)-nitrogen bonds have been estimated.
